How does a pink diamond get its color?

While it is still not clear about the source of color, it is believed that pink diamonds get their color due to the immense pressure they endure beneath the earth’s surface.

What color shades do the pink diamonds have?

The pink diamonds occur in colors ranging from brown-pink to purple-pink. Some pink diamonds have orange hues too. The ideal pink diamond exhibits pure pink color. A bright pink diamond is more valuable than a light pink diamond. But there are other properties like clarity, cut, and carat weight that decide the overall value.

Where are the pink diamonds found?

The pink diamonds were first discovered in the Kollur Mine of India. They were then mined from the Minas Gerais region of Brazil. But now, 80% of the pink diamonds originate from Argyle mine in Kimberley, Australia.  

Why are the pink diamonds classified as Type IIa diamonds?

Pink diamonds form under intense pressure for longer time durations. They have no nitrogen impurities that cause a yellow or brown tint. The color intensity is divided on a scale from one to nine. 9 is the lightest color in pink diamond and 1 is the darkest. The Argyle Mine has its pink diamond color classification system.

Which is the largest pink diamond in the world?

The largest pink diamond in the world is the Pink Star. Formerly known as Steinmetz Pink, it weighs 59.60 carats and is rated as the fancy vivid pink color by the GIA. The Pink Star is from the De Beers mine in South Africa. It was sold to Chow Tai Fook Enterprises at an auction in 2017. The value for it was $71.2 million.  

Is pink diamond expensive?

The cost of a pink diamond depends on its color variation. The brownish pink diamonds are affordable, but the purplish-pink diamonds are costly. A half-carat pink diamond price can range from $50,000 to $100,000. It zooms to $500,000 and above for a 2 carat stone.   

What are some interesting facts about pink diamonds?

  • Pink diamonds were first discovered in India in the Kollur mine of Andhra Pradesh.
  • Now, 80% of them originate from the Argyle mine in Kimberley, Australia. Out of the mine’s total output, only 0.1% are classified as pink diamonds.
  • The earliest known pink diamonds are part of the Iranian crown jewels.
  • Dr. John Williamson, a Canadian geologist, gave a 23.6-carat pink diamond to Queen Elizabeth II.
